So many of us make excuses for other people's behavior on the off-chance that there might also be some good behavior if we wait around.
Oftentimes, we learn to accept this behavior from family and from other experiences while growing up, but this doesn't mean we have to allow this to continue as adults. We can choose not to accept other's actions and what's more empowering is we don't have to let their actions mean anything about us. #stillpracticing
What matters is you think that you matter. When you genuinely hold this belief in your heart, you won't make time or space for people who can't give you what you need.
